Subject: [PATCH 3.0] fix compile warnings in plat-iop/cp6.c

Building 3.0 for an n2100 (plat-iop) results in:

In file included from arch/arm/plat-iop/cp6.c:20:
/tmp/linux-3.0/arch/arm/include/asm/traps.h:12: warning: 'struct pt_regs' declared inside parameter list
/tmp/linux-3.0/arch/arm/include/asm/traps.h:12: warning: its scope is only this definition or declaration, which is probably not what you want
/tmp/linux-3.0/arch/arm/include/asm/traps.h:48: warning: 'struct pt_regs' declared inside parameter list
/tmp/linux-3.0/arch/arm/include/asm/traps.h:48: warning: 'struct task_struct' declared inside parameter list
arch/arm/plat-iop/cp6.c:45: warning: initialization from incompatible pointer type

The pt_regs and incompatible pointer type warnings are fixed by including
<asm/ptrace.h> before <asm/traps.h>.  Nothing here depends on task_struct,
so that warning can be fixed by a forward struct declaration.

Signed-off-by: Mikael Pettersson <mikpe@it.uu.se>
---
--- linux-3.0/arch/arm/plat-iop/cp6.c.~1~	2011-07-22 12:01:07.000000000 +0200
+++ linux-3.0/arch/arm/plat-iop/cp6.c	2011-07-22 14:26:51.000000000 +0200
@@ -17,8 +17,9 @@
  *
  */
 #include <linux/init.h>
-#include <asm/traps.h>
 #include <asm/ptrace.h>
+struct task_struct;
+#include <asm/traps.h>
 
 static int cp6_trap(struct pt_regs *regs, unsigned int instr)
 {
